Healing Communities Training is a national model for clergy and congregations to offer restoration and healing for everyone affected by the criminal justice system and become a station of hope. The class is sponsored by the EPA Conference Prison Ministry & Restorative Justice Team and the GNJ Leadership Academy.  Class sessions will be from 7-9 PM on October 20, 22, 27 and 29. Two hours of pre-class work is required in addition to the zoom classes for 10 hours credit for EPA CSM, CLM and clergy and GNJ CSM and Lay Servants.

The instructor for the course is Linda Van Til, Certified lay Minister, EPA Conference UMC, Prison Ministry & Restorative Justice Work Team and Healing Communities Trainer. Preaching CAREfully is an advanced course in speaking that unites the roles of caring and speaking for true pastoral preaching, recalling the days of the early church when the pastor was called to be a “shepherd of souls.”  The class is sponsored by the EPAUMC Laity  Academy and is open to lay servants in EPA and GNJ who have completed the Basic Course for Lay Servants and a Preaching 1 or Speaking 1 course. Class sessions will be on Zoom on October 9, from 7 – 9 PM, and on October 10 and 17, from 9 AM till noon.  Two hours of pre-class work includes readings from I Am the Lord Who Heals You, by G. Scott Morris  and is required for 10 hours of credit for Lay Servants, Christ Servant Ministers, and CLM’s.

The instructor for the course is Rev Dr. Lloyd Speer, III, senior pastor at Christ United Methodist Church of Fairless Hills. Registration details are available at the link: Members Responsive Portal – Fall 2026 EPAUMC Preaching Carefully Laity Academy Course
